1. Understand Your Requirements

Before diving into options, ask yourself, “What do I need?” This question is crucial. Different locations have different requirements. For instance, a busy intersection might need a sturdier pole than one in a quiet neighborhood.

2. Consider Material Options

Traffic light poles come in various materials. Common choices include:

  • Steel
  • Aluminum
  • Fiberglass

Each material has its pros and cons. “Steel is super strong but may rust,” one expert noted. “Aluminum is lightweight but can be less durable.” Think about your environment before deciding.

3. Assess Height and Visibility

How tall should your traffic light pole be? This is important for visibility. Typically, poles range from 10 to 25 feet tall. Taller poles can be seen from a greater distance. “We want to ensure the signals are not obstructed,” a city planner explained. So, height matters for safety!
